This special edition of Contemporary Studies in Economics and Financial Analysis offers a selection of carefully curated chapters from invited participants in the International Applied Social Science Congress 4-6 April 2019. In these chapters, expert authors tackle issues across a variety of economic and financial disciplines. Chapters include: the role of bankruptcy risk prediction in assuring the financial performance of Romanian industrial capitals; the effects of female employment on economic growth; perceived exchange rates and exchange rate management techniques; the European Union's anti-discrimination laws in sport; bank stability in Latvia; and many more. With vigorous academic rigour, the authors and editors to this volume bring to life a wide variety of economic and financial discussions, from theory to practice.
